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.
The Rails Shell view is a good example of why I prefer RadRails over other existing IDEs. Someone asked in the Aptana forums if RadRails could incorporate a nice feature he saw in a different IDE. Chris Williams, the lead developer of RadRails, asked him to enter the desired features into the Aptana Issues Tracker, where you can report any bugs or ask for any functionalities you would like to see in RadRails. Some months later, in RadRails 1.0, the Rails Shell view was already available.
From the Rails Shell view, you can have the best of two worlds: the power of the command line and the ease of use of a development IDE. You can basically run rails-related commands from a command shell with content-assist.